Mich. Comp. Laws § 777.34 : CODE OF CRIMINAL PROCEDURE —SENTENCING GUIDELINES — OFFENSE VARIABLES — Psychological injury to victim
(1) Offense variable 4 is psychological injury to a victim. Score offense variable 4 by determining which of the following apply and by assigning the number of points attributable to the one that has the highest number of points:
(a) Serious psychological injury requiring professional treatment occurred to a victim................................. 10 points
(b) For a conviction under section 50b of the Michigan penal code, 1931 PA 328, MCL
750.50b, seriouspsychological injury requiring professional treatment occurred to the owner of a companion animal............... 5 points
(c) No serious psychological injury requiring professional treatment occurred to a victim........................... 0 points
(2) Score 10 points if the serious psychological injury may require professional treatment. In making this determination, the fact that treatment has not been sought is not conclusive.
